Saturday Scripture: Acts 1:12-26
- Tell the story: The disciples, including the eleven remaining apostles, Mary of Nazareth, and some other women, gathered in Jerusalem for the festival of Pentecost. Because Judas had betrayed Jesus and died, they needed a new twelfth apostle. They discerned two people who would do well, prayed, and chose between them by lots - kind of like drawing straws. Matthias became the twelfth apostle.
